Title :
Distributed beamforming for High Speed Railway

Abstract :
In this paper, we introduce an algorithm of distributed beamforming for High Speed Railway (HSR) based on the idea of location assistant beamforming. In the new algorithm, the weights are calculated from direction of departure (DOD) of two direct paths since two receive antennas are placed in long distance. The performance of new algorithm with accurate position information and position error under Gaussian and uniform distributions are both evaluated. Simulation results show that distributed beamforming algorithm has better performance and strong robustness against position error.
